eng Volatmmetric determination of lead and cadmium in selected sediments at the glassy carbon electrode modified with bismuth nanoparticles and carbon nanotubes A new type of bismuth electrode based on the glassy carbon surface modified with bismuth nanoparticles and multiwalled carbon nanotubes is proposed for the determination of Cd(II) and Pb(II) ions at the µg L-1 concentration level in combination with square-wave anodic stripping voltammetry. Key operational parameters nwere optimized. The electrode of interest exhibited well-developed signals and pretty linear calibration plots for both metal ions tested in the concentration range from 5.0 to 50.0 µg L-1. The applicability of the new electrode was demonstrated on the analysis of sediments collected at Great Bačka Canal.
